前端设计领域也日新月异。CSS3渐变技术的出现,为网页设计带来了前所未有的视觉冲击力。本文将从CSS3渐变的原理、应用场景、制作方法以及发展趋势等方面进行探讨,以期为我国前端设计师提供有益的参考。

一、CSS3渐变的原理

CSS3渐变技术视觉美学的创新之旅  第1张

CSS3渐变是一种将颜色从一种状态平滑过渡到另一种状态的技术。其原理是将多个颜色按照一定比例分配到一条直线上,通过线性或径向渐变的方式,将颜色混合在一起,形成连续的颜色变化。

渐变类型主要包括以下两种:

1. 线性渐变(linear-gradient)

线性渐变是指颜色沿着一条直线方向进行变化。其语法格式如下:

```

linear-gradient(to right, red, yellow, green);

```

上述代码表示从左到右依次过渡为红色、黄色和绿色。

2. 径向渐变(radial-gradient)

径向渐变是指颜色从圆心向四周发散。其语法格式如下:

```

radial-gradient(circle, red, yellow, green);

```

上述代码表示从圆心开始,颜色依次过渡为红色、黄色和绿色。

二、CSS3渐变的应用场景

1. 背景渐变

背景渐变是CSS3渐变应用最广泛的一种场景。通过背景渐变,可以为网页添加丰富的视觉层次感,提升用户体验。

2. 边框渐变

边框渐变可以使网页元素的边框呈现出丰富的颜色变化,增强视觉效果。

3. 文本渐变

文本渐变可以将文字的颜色进行渐变处理,使文字更具立体感和视觉冲击力。

4. 阴影渐变

阴影渐变可以使网页元素的阴影呈现出丰富的颜色变化,增强立体感。

三、CSS3渐变的制作方法

1. 线性渐变制作方法

线性渐变的制作方法相对简单,只需在CSS样式中添加`linear-gradient`属性即可。

2. 径向渐变制作方法

径向渐变的制作方法与线性渐变类似,只需将`linear-gradient`属性替换为`radial-gradient`属性。

四、CSS3渐变的发展趋势

1. 丰富渐变类型

随着前端技术的发展,未来CSS3渐变的类型将更加丰富,如圆锥渐变、球面渐变等。

2. 渐变性能优化

为了提高网页的加载速度,未来CSS3渐变的性能将得到优化,降低资源消耗。

3. 渐变动画应用

CSS3渐变可以与动画技术相结合,实现动态的渐变效果,为网页设计带来更多可能性。

CSS3渐变技术为网页设计带来了前所未有的视觉冲击力,丰富了网页的视觉效果。作为前端设计师,我们应该熟练掌握CSS3渐变技术,将其运用到实际项目中,为用户带来更加愉悦的浏览体验。关注CSS3渐变技术的发展趋势,不断提升自己的设计水平。

参考文献:

[1] 张三,李四. CSS3渐变技术及其应用[J]. 网页设计与应用,2019(2):20-25.

[2] 王五,赵六. CSS3渐变与动画技术结合的应用研究[J]. 前端开发与设计,2018(3):28-32.